Swiss Spirit project temporarily suspended

© Planetlemans - Marcel ten Caat

Defined as "a diffcult choice" that should be benefitial for the continuation of their LMP1 racing programme, the temporary suspension of the Swiss Spirit program was confirmed today at the Nürburgring. The press release was brief and had no details whatsoever, just that they are skipping the German round of the LMS. We hope the team will be back at Spa for the next round of the Le Mans Series.
A real shame for a highly competitive team that achieved a podium already in its Valencia 1000 km debut. The "petrol car benchmark" as defined by Audi is therefore in an impasse until at least mid-August.
